1.1 Why Database Infrastructure Drives Technology Costs
Databases often represent one of the largest cost components of financial technology infrastructure because they consume significant computing resources, including:
-
Processing power
-
Memory capacity
-
Storage resources
-
Network bandwidth
As workloads increase and digital services expand, database infrastructure costs can grow rapidly.
Without proper visibility into how these resources are used, organizations risk overprovisioning infrastructure, inefficient query workloads, and uncontrolled technology spending.

3. Cost Attribution Challenges in Financial Data Platforms
Cost attribution refers to the process of assigning infrastructure costs to the specific applications, services, or business units that consume those resources.
Unfortunately, traditional cost allocation methods often lack the precision required for modern data environments.
3.1 Shared Infrastructure Environments
Many financial systems run on shared database platforms, making it difficult to determine which workloads are responsible for specific resource usage.
3.2 Dynamic Workloads
Financial transactions and analytics workloads fluctuate constantly, especially during market volatility or peak trading hours.
3.3 Limited Visibility into Query Behavior
Without detailed analysis of SQL queries and database activity, organizations cannot accurately determine how applications consume infrastructure resources.
These challenges create blind spots in financial technology cost management.
